Tori Posted March 22, 2012 Posted March 22, 2012 ...I joined this forum not so long ago and I can't find out anywhere, what does UBOTY Winner means?Ultimate Babe of the Year.It was a contest held in the early days of BZ as an extension of the old contests that used to have at the ChilaX forums. Bellazon was started after that forum closed, and some of the members wanted to continue the Babe of the Year voting we used to do at ChilaX. Since anyone who won Babe of the Year couldn't be in the competition anymore (and Adriana won one of the years over at ChilaX) they basically had a contest for the ineligible models.You would have had to be around for the ChilaX days to really understand it.
